Specifications and technical data
- SKU: 3DD951221A
- Mark: Volkswagen
- Condition: Used
- OEM Part Number: 3DD951221A
- Substitutable numbers: 3DD951221A, 3DD 951 221 A, 6N0951223A, 6N0 951 223 A
- Category: Horns
Purpose and function of the low-tone horn
The presented low-tone sound signal has been designed as an element of the factory warning system in the first-generation Touareg model. It is responsible for generating the lower part of the acoustic spectrum, which, when combined with the high-tone signal, creates a characteristic, clearly audible warning sound. This provides the driver with a clear, homologated signal that improves road safety.
